  • How to split Equity between cofounders
    • More equity = more motivation
    • Takes 7 to 10 years to build a company, small variations first year doesn't justify equity differences.
    • Startup is about execution, not the idea. No need to giveundue preference to co-foudner who came up with idea, as opposed to small group who got product to market.
  • Order of Operations for starting a Startup
    • Particular problem you're interested about? Prob can come from experience growing up, personal interest, school, work.
    • Find some friends and braistorm potential solutions to the problem. Pick people that are fun to brainstorm with, not that reject potential soutions. You need to have that spark. People who also brainstorm feel more ownership over solution, which helps later on.
    • Turn spark into a fucking fire. Work teotgether and build anMVP. resist temptation to build complete solution. Build stripped down version and see whether users actually want to use it.
    • Addendum: Good investors are interested in teams currently in process of executing their idea and tend to shy away from teams that are just pitching their idea.
